Making Spirits Bright

Every hostess with the mostess knows the importance of a well-stocked bar. Especially around the holidays, you never know when you might receive an unexpected visitor! 

Stocking a bar is slow process, as my roommate and I are discovering. Sure, you could go out and buy everything you need all at once, but I can't even image how expensive that would be. Plus, it's fun to find little objects every now and then to add to your collection! I love scouring antique and flea markets for one-of-a-kind pieces.

Below are some of my favorite choices for a home bar...

Proof that it is possible to decorate for Halloween on a budget without looking like you bought all your decorations from WalMart or the Dollar Tree! 

It's as easy as printing out a spooky skeleton or bat and popping it into an antique frame, or wrapping some black lace around white candles.

Even just painting pumpkins white and adding some fall leaves makes such a statement without spending a lot. And my favorite.. that skull pillow cover is only $35 from Zara Home!

Summer Macaroni Salad with Tomatoes and Zucchini



Pinned Image
This recipe from Skinnytaste looks SO yummy!



Ingredients:
16 oz uncooked elbows
4 cups grape tomatoes, cut in half
2 cups (1 small) zucchini, sliced and quartered
1/2 cup red onion, finely chopped
7 tbsp light mayonnaise (Hellman's)
2 1/2 tbsp red wine vinegar
2 tbsp fat free Greek yogurt
2 tsp Dijon mustard
1/4 tsp oregano
1/4 tsp garlic powder
salt and pepper to taste










Jello Shots!
Blue Layer
2 boxes berry blue gelatin dessert mix (3.1 oz)
1 1/2 cups water
2 envelope plain gelatin
1 cup flavored rum or vodka
Red Layer
2 boxes raspberry, strawberry or cherry gelatin dessert mix (3.1 oz)
1 1/2 cups water
2 envelope plain gelatin
1 cup flavored rum or vodka
White Layer
2 ¾ cups water
6 envelopes plain gelatin
3/4 cup sweetened condensed milk
1 cup flavored rum or vodka
1/2 cup white crème de cacao (or white chocolate liqueur)
